Sex Workers - Grievances

We have had a series of consultations with residents, sex workers and businesses. At each consultation, we asked people to share their individual concerns regarding the issues of street level sex work. Listed below are some of the many grievances shared by community members. This information is intended to create awareness around the impact that street level sex work has on all members of our community. Help us move towards common ground as we start to improve the health and safety of our neighbourhoods together.
